Mechanisms of Thin Film Growth and the Influence of Surface Chemistry on Film Growth and Properties

Abstract

THIS PROGRAM WAS A FUNDAMENTAL RESEARCH STUDY OF THE MECHANISMS OF THIN FILM GROWTH AND THE INFLUENCE OF SURFACE CHEMISTRY ON FILM GROWTH AND PROPERTIES. THE FILM GROWTH TECHNIQUES BEING EMPHASIZED INCLUDE PULSE LASER DEPOSITION AND MOLECULAR BEAM EPITAXY. THIS IS A BIBLIOGRAPHY OF THE PUBLICATIONS GENERATED BY THIS PROGRAM.
